Who lives here?

Port Union, Toronto is an east Toronto neighbourhood notable for its university grads, executives and business, science and education, law & public sector professionals. Residents tend to be older with a significant number of kids aged 10 to 14, youth aged 15 to 24, adults aged 50 to 64 and seniors aged 65 to 74.
